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
666083180 54841811829 9114905
17 65443880 1555
17 65443880 1555
95961544329 55531126 05 63
All about undefined
Interested in learning more?
17 65443880 1555
95961544329 55531126 05 63
See more
745727 45940 138224
19311 51 9751169 95531231715
See more
487641 79561063 0192
34 397 269 873247950
See more